/// Uses a non-cryptographic hash to detect config file changes.
/// Returns 0 on read error so reload logic stays conservative.
fn hash_config_file(path: &PathBuf) -> u64 {
    use std::collections::hash_map::DefaultHasher;
    use std::hash::{Hash, Hasher};

    match std::fs::read(path) {
        Ok(bytes) => {
            let mut hasher = DefaultHasher::new();
            bytes.hash(&mut hasher);
            hasher.finish()
        }
        Err(_) => 0,
    }
}

    /// Reloads configuration from disk without restarting the app.
    pub fn reload(&mut self) -> Result<(), ConfigError> {
        let mut stack = std::collections::HashSet::new();
        let (new_config, new_warnings, new_val_warnings) =
            Config::load_merged(&self.config_path, &mut stack)?;
        let resolved = new_config.resolve()?;

        self.config_hash = hash_config_file(&self.config_path);

        let old_expanded = self.expanded_items.clone();
        let old_idx = self.selected_index;

        self.config = new_config;
        self.keep_open = self
            .config
            .defaults
            .as_ref()
            .and_then(|d| d.keep_open)
            .unwrap_or(false);
        self.resolved_servers = resolved;
        self.warnings = new_warnings;
        self.validation_warnings = new_val_warnings;
        self.expanded_items = old_expanded;
        self.items_dirty = true;
        self.selected_index = old_idx;
        self.list_state.select(Some(old_idx));

        let count = self.resolved_servers.len();
        self.set_status_message(fl!("config-reloaded", count = (count as i64)));
        Ok(())
    }
